The Pale Blue Eye Movie
"The Pale Blue Eye" is a chilling mystery set in the snowy Hudson Valley of 1830s New York. The story follows retired lawman Augustus Landor, played by Christian Bale, as he investigates the murder of a cadet at the West Point Military Academy. As Landor delves deeper into the case, he uncovers a sinister plot involving devil worship and corpse mutilation. Alongside him is the academy's outcast, Edgar Allan Poe, played by Harry Melling, who helps to uncover the truth. With a limited cast of characters, the film keeps its audience guessing until the end, and ultimately delivers a powerful tale of loss and the darker aspects of the human psyche. The story is adapted from a novel by Louis Bayard, and is directed by Scott Cooper.

Exploration of the Topical and Timeless Issues Facing Humanity. One of the most pressing issues facing humanity today is climate change. The Earth's climate is warming at an alarming rate, primarily due to human activities such as the burning of fossil fuels and deforestation. The effects of climate change can be seen all around the world, from the melting of Arctic sea ice to the increase in severe weather events. The consequences of climate change are far-reaching and potentially catastrophic, including rising sea levels, food and water shortages, and the extinction of many species.
